20080219366 | COMBINED RATE AND PRECODER DESIGN FOR SLOW FADING CORRELATED MIMO CHANNELS WITH LIMITED FEEDBACK - System and methodologies are provided herein for joint rate, precoder, and feedback design adaptation and optimization for wireless communication systems. An optimization component as provided herein can implement an integrated framework for joint design of rate, preceding, and feedback partitioning adaptation policies for slow fading and spatially correlated multiple-input multiple-output (MIMO) communication channels with limited feedback. The optimization component can utilize one or more vector quantization (VQ) optimization techniques wherein a feedback strategy and a transmission adaptation strategy are designed to jointly optimize average system goodput (e.g., average bits/second/Hz successfully delivered to a receiver) based on spatial correlation of the communication channels. In one example, a feedback strategy is designed as a channel state information of receiver (CSIR) partition and a transmission adaptation strategy is designed as rate and precoder codebooks. | 09-11-2008 |

20130212871 | MANUFACTURING METHOD OF A SLIDER AND MANUFACTURING APPARATUS THEREOF - A manufacturing method of a slider includes steps of (a) providing a row bar with a plurality of slider elements connecting together, the row bar having an air bearing surface, a back surface opposite the air bearing surface, a bonding surface and a bottom surface opposite the bonding surface; (b) grinding the bottom surface of the row bar; (c) lapping the air bearing surface of the row bar so as to obtain a predetermined requirement, and applying a first magnetic field with a first direction during lapping the air bearing surface, and the first direction being parallel to the air bearing surface and the bonding surface; and (d) cutting the row bar into a plurality of individual sliders. The present invention can maintain a good performance of a magnetic head during the manufacturing process. | 08-22-2013 |
20130219699 | MANUFACTURING METHOD OF A SLIDER AND MANUFACTURING APPARATUS THEREOF - A manufacturing method of a slider includes steps of: (a) providing a row bar with a plurality of slider elements connecting together; (b) lapping surfaces of the row bar so as to obtain a predetermined requirement; (c) lowering the temperature of the surfaces lapped in the step (b) before and/or during lapping; and (d) cutting the row bar into a plurality of sliders. The present invention can prevent a local high temperature generated on the magnetic head during lapping so that the performance of the magnetic head is improved. | 08-29-2013 |

20120183912 | GAS LIGHTER WITH SAFETY MECHANISM - A gas lighter with safety mechanism comprising an inner frame mounted on top of a fuel reservoir and provided with a valve for releasing fuel contained in the fuel reservoir; an outer frame mounted on top of the inner frame and having two supports each of which is provided with a L-shaped supporting hole including a vertical section and a horizontal section; a lever sandwiched between the two supports and pivotable with respect to the outer frame to actuate the valve; a flint disposed between the two supports; a friction wheel rotatably sleeved on a shaft between the two supports, the shaft are movably supported in the supporting holes, the friction wheel is separate from the flint when the shaft is moved to the vertical sections while contacts the flint to enable to generate sparks by rotating the friction wheel when the shaft is moved to the horizontal sections. | 07-19-2012 |

20090198373 | AUTOMATED DISPENSER WITH A PAPER SENSING SYSTEM - A dispenser for dispensing a portion of sheet product stored in a dispenser, in which a dispensed sheet portion is to be removed by tearing the sheet portion from the remaining product supply. The dispenser includes a system which detects the presence of sheet product in a region of a dispensing outlet. Upon detection of a potential user, the sensing system causes dispensing of paper, on the condition that the sheet portion is regarded as having been torn off. The system includes elements for detecting a discontinuity in the sheet product. | 08-06-2009 |

20080239305 | Reticle assembly of aiming device - A reticle assembly of an aiming device is provided. The reticle assembly includes an illumination source, a first optical mask and a second optical mask. The first optical mask has a plurality of optical openings which define a reticle pattern. The first optical mask is mounted in a fixed position. The second optical mask is movably positioned relative to the first optical mask. The second optical mask has a plurality of masking portions adapted to block selected portions of the reticle pattern. The illumination source is adapted to project a plurality of output patterns which correspond to unblocked portions of the reticle pattern. | 10-02-2008 |

20080309916 | Auto Aim Reticle For Laser range Finder Scope - A laser range finder scope for measuring the distance between a target and the scope based on the time-of-flight of laser impulses is disclosed as including means for transmitting laser impulses toward the target and generating a first time signal corresponding to the transmission; means for receiving laser impulses reflected from the target and generating a second time signal corresponding to the reception; means for delaying said first time signal to provide a third time signal; means for calculating the time-of-flight by comparing said second time signal and third time signal; and a scope with a reticle with a plurality of indicia selectively lightable to each indicate the appropriate reticle scale to aim at the target. | 12-18-2008 |
20090059219 | Electronic Multi-Reticle Pattern Scope - A scope is disclosed as including a display to display a plurality of reticle-patterns, means for selecting one of the reticle-patterns to be displayed by the display, and an optical prism for projecting the displayed reticle-pattern onto a piece of lens viewable by a user. | 03-05-2009 |

20110043181 | Single-inductor-multiple-output regulator with auto-hopping control and the method of use - A switching regulator is provided herein comprising a voltage source, a plurality of switching elements, an inductive element, and a controller. The controller coordinates the plurality of switching elements as to sequentially and periodically switching the inductive element to generate a plurality of regulated DC voltages. The controller adjusts a switching frequency of the regulator in accordance with at least one characteristic of a load current. | 02-24-2011 |
20120286576 | Single-inductor-multiple-output regulator with synchronized current mode hysteretic control - A single-inductor-multiple-output (SIMO) DC-DC switching regulator with a current-mode hysteretic control technique having an ultra-fast transient response to suppress cross-regulation is provided. The DC-DC switching regulator includes: at least one power source for providing electrical energy; an inductive energy storage element for accumulating and transferring the electrical energy from the input power source to a plurality of outputs; a main switch for controlling energy accumulation at the inductive energy storage element; a plurality of output switches for controlling energy transfer to each of the plurality of outputs; a freewheel switch coupled in parallel with the inductive energy storage element; and a controller, configured to coordinate the plurality of output switches and the main switch. | 11-15-2012 |

20100193207 | POWER TOOL CHUCK ASSEMBLY WITH HAMMER MECHANISM - A power tool includes a housing, a motor supported in the housing, a chuck assembly having a chuck body rotatable about a central axis in response to torque received from the motor, and a plurality of jaws supported in the chuck body. Each of the jaws includes a front portion operable to grasp a tool element and a rear portion positioned outside the chuck body. The power tool also includes a hammer mechanism operable to impart movement to the chuck assembly, in a direction parallel to the central axis, during rotation of the chuck assembly about the central axis. | 08-05-2010 |

20080252726 | Video aid system - A work device is disclosed that comprises a body and a drive portion attached with the body for working on a workpiece. At least one camera is attached with the body, and at least one video display device is operatively connected with the at least one camera. The camera is positioned on the body at an angle that is not perpendicular to the workpiece when the workpiece is positioned to be worked on by the drive portion. The at least one camera transmits images to the at least one video display. | 10-16-2008 |

20120007467 | COMMUTATOR - A commutator has a plurality of commutator segments fixed to an insulating support member. The commutator segments are formed by cold or hot forming a copper billet cut from a length of copper wire. Each billet has a volume approximately equal to the volume of one commutator segment. Each commutator segment has a main body and an anchor integrally formed with the main body. The commutator segments are spaced about a circle and then an insulating support member is molded to the commutator segments to fix the commutator segments to the support member. | 01-12-2012 |

20120099227 | Magnetoresistive Sensor, magnetic head, head gimbal assembly and disk drive unit with the same - A MR sensor comprises a first shielding layer, a second shielding layer, a MR element and a pair of hard magnet layers sandwiched therebetween, and a non-magnetic insulating layer formed at a side of the MR element far from an air bearing surface of a slider. The MR sensor further comprises a first non-magnetic conducting layer formed between the first shielding layer and the MR element, and the first non-magnetic conducting layer is embedded in the first shielding layer and kept separate from the ABS. The MR sensor of the invention can obtain a narrower read gap to increase the resolution power and improve the reading performance, and obtain a strong longitudinal bias field to stabilize the MR sensor so as to increase the total sensor area and, in turn, get an improved reliability and performance. The present invention also discloses a magnetic head, a HGA and a disk drive unit. | 04-26-2012 |
20120249130 | Method for measuring longitudinal bias magnetic field in a tunnel magnetoresistive sensor - A method for measuring longitudinal bias magnetic field in a tunnel magnetoresistive sensor of a magnetic head, the method includes the steps of: applying an external longitudinal time-changing magnetic field onto the tunnel magnetoresistive sensor; determining a shield saturation value of the tunnel magnetoresistive sensor under the application of the external longitudinal time-changing magnetic field; applying an external transverse time-changing magnetic field and an external longitudinal DC magnetic field onto the tunnel magnetoresistive sensor; determining a plurality of different output amplitudes under the application of the external transverse time-changing magnetic field and the application of different field strength values of the external longitudinal DC magnetic field; plotting a graph according to the different output amplitudes and the different field strength values; and determining the strength of the longitudinal bias magnetic field according to the graph and the shield saturation value. | 10-04-2012 |

20110014953 | USER INPUT ASSEMBLY FOR AN ELECTRONIC DEVICE - A touch sensitive user input assembly for enter characters into an electronic device. During a telephone mode, use of the input assembly may be made to enter telephone numbers by touching predetermined areas of the input assembly. During a text entry mode, the user may enter characters from a larger character set, including letters, numbers, symbols, emoticons, accent markings, or other characters. In this mode, the user may tap one of the predetermined areas to enter a character that has been previously associated with this action. The predetermined area also may be used to enter additional previously associated characters by touching the predefined area and then dragging in a predetermined direction to cycle through plural character choices. When a desired character is reached, the user may release his or her finger from the keypad to enter the desired character. | 01-20-2011 |

20130180878 | PLASTIC PACKAGING, AND METHOD AND APPARATUS FOR PRODUCING SAME - A plastic package uses a substrate and an overlay, where both the substrate and the overlay are of materials which can be recycled together, for example polyethylene terephthalate (PET). The plastic used for the overlay may be different from the plastic used for the substrate, provided that the plastics are of the same thermoplastic family, or are of types which are compatible for recycling together. A method of making the package includes the steps of: positioning the product on a vacuum-forming fixture; heating a first layer of thermoplastic, positioning it over the product, and applying a vacuum to the fixture to pull the first layer of thermoplastic onto the product; and thermally bonding the first layer and a second layer of recycling-compatible thermoplastic to each other with the product between them, so as to capture the product. Apparatus having lease two stations is provided to carry out the method and thereby produce the package. | 07-18-2013 |

20090100652 | Buckle with Safety Latch - A buckle, operating between a locked position and a released position, comprising a male buckle member having a plurality of locking members, and a female buckle member. The female buckle member includes a housing, a plurality of engaging portions formed on the housing for engaging with the locking members, a latch member slidably disposed in the housing for preventing the locking members from disengaging with the engaging portions in the locked position, and a bias device connecting the latch member to the housing for biasing said latch member against the locking member in the locked position. | 04-23-2009 |
